¶1We overrule the motion to dismiss the appeal, holding that the court, in Marshall v. Reed, 5 Penn. 462, 61 Atl. 945, virtually covered this point.
29 Del. 144
Stellar v. Long
Decided January 28, 1916
Superior Court of Delaware · decided 1916-01-28
Appeal by Frederick Stellar from a. judgment rendered against him by a justice of the peace in favor of Eugene Long. On motion to dismiss the appeal on the ground that the certificate of the justice to the transcript of the record filed did not meet the requirements of Section 3987, Revised Code of 1915. Lewis v. Hazel, 4 Harr. 470; Barker v. David, 4 Penn. 395, 55 Ail. 334; Peninsula Cut Stone Co. v. Nixon, 3 Boyce 339, 83 Ail. 1081.
